Quote: sillybear
Quote: AeronPeryton
You converted the .ogg file to .mp3? So without saving space or improving compatibility you decreased the audio quality? What for?
I know it's not space saving but I just follow the standard in official DDR simfile making here in z-i-v. Don't worry, I don't transcode directly from ogg or the original file in general. I converted the ogg first (or the original file) to raw wav format before transcoding to mp3 320kbps format. So the audio quality should not decrease at least from the original file. That's my way.
Cons for not making it to mp3 320 kbps is because there are times when i cannot snap/track the desired time for sample music start, especially for 192 and below kbps quality.
The point is that .ogg is either better quality at the same size or the same quality at a smaller size. I made a detailed post on this before, because there is no reason to intentionally stick with .mp3 but every reason to move to .ogg. Every version of StepMania decodes .ogg and several versions (in the groove anything for example) doesn't support .mp3.
As for bad snapping at low quality... well, what you did essentially lowered the quality. If you're going to arbitrarily hike up the bitrate, just do that to the .ogg instead. I'm pretty sure the snapping issue is for low bitrate .mp3s, not .oggs.
I'm not saying that you need to start converting the whole library to .ogg, just that since the file was already properly formatted there was no reason to mess with it. That's like taking a 640x480 background and reformatting it at 320x240 in the name of dated standards.
